Joshua D. Craig, 22, of Greenfield, IN. died as a result of injuries sustained in a single vehicle automobile accident near West Point, IN. on Thursday January 24, 2013. Joshua was born in Bicester RAS, Upper Harford, England September 5, 1990, the son of David Craig and Martina (Preston) Sternberg. He was a graduate of the American Schools in England, and was currently a student at IVY Tech in Lafayette in the HVAC Program. Joshua married Jamey N. Sanchez at Plainfield, IN. February 5, 2011 and she survives. He attended St. Mary's Cathedral; loved the outdoors, martial arts, bow hunting and hanging out with his children. Joshua was a very loving and caring person. Surviving with his wife is his mother and step-father, Martina and Scott Sternberg of West Point, IN.; his father, David Craig of Korea; four sons, Gabriel Craig, Nathan, Noah and Seth Stepler all at home; his sister, Jessica Craig, stationed at Ft. Bragg, NC.; maternal grandmother, Delores Henry of Indianapolis, IN.; paternal grandparents, Ted and Emma Jane Craig of Columbia, MO.; and a step-grandmother, Nancy Oakland of Destin, FL. Friends may call at the Hahn-Groeber Funeral Home, 1104 Columbia St., Lafayette from 5 until 7 PM Monday, with the Rosary service at 4:45 PM and a Celebration of Life Service at 7:00 PM. Mass of Christian Burial will be held at St. Mary's Cathedral at 10:30 AM Tuesday, Fr. Jeff Martin officiating, with interment to follow in St. Mary's Cemetery. If friends desire, memorials may be made to the Joshua Craig Trust Fund for his children.
